Reading and Writing Exercises

This page contains reading comprehension questions and a writing prompt related to "The Hunger Games", focusing on Chapter 2 and the aftermath of the reaping.

The reading questions delve into key aspects of the story:

  1. Katniss's connection to Peeta and her sense of owing him something.
  2. The differences in volunteering between districts and the reasons behind these variations.
  3. The significance of the dandelion Katniss saw after her father's death and how it gave her hope.

Highlight: These questions encourage deeper analysis of character relationships, societal structures within Panem, and symbolic elements in the story.

The writing exercise prompts students to imagine and script a final conversation between Katniss and Gale in the woods before she leaves for the Capitol. This creative task allows students to explore the characters' emotions and thoughts more deeply.

Example: The prompt provides a structure for the dialogue, with starting phrases for both Gale and Katniss, such as "Oh, Katniss, I cannot believe what you did today!" and "You know Gale..."

This exercise not only enhances writing skills but also promotes empathy and character understanding. Students are encouraged to act out their dialogues, adding a performative element to their learning experience.

Vocabulary: Reaping - The annual event where tributes are chosen for the Hunger Games.

These activities provide a comprehensive approach to studying "The Hunger Games", combining textual analysis, creative writing, and performance to deepen students' engagement with the novel.

Dialogue Between Gale and Katniss

This page presents a poignant conversation between Gale Hawthorne and Katniss Everdeen following the reaping for the Hunger Games. The dialogue captures their emotions and concerns as Katniss prepares to leave for the Capitol.

Gale expresses his disbelief at Katniss's decision to volunteer as tribute. Katniss explains that she had to protect her sister Prim, who wouldn't have survived the games. Gale reassures Katniss that he will take care of her family, providing a sense of relief amidst the turmoil.

Quote: "Oh, Gale, this is going to be so terrifying. But I could not live with the thought of letting my sister take part in the games. She is so weak and couldn't hurt a fly."

The conversation delves into the moral complexities of the Hunger Games. Gale advises Katniss to use her hunting skills, suggesting that killing humans for survival is no different from hunting animals. Katniss, however, grapples with the ethical implications of taking human life.

Highlight: Katniss's internal conflict between survival and maintaining her humanity is a central theme in "The Hunger Games".

Gale encourages Katniss to use her family as motivation to survive, demonstrating his practical approach to the situation. The dialogue concludes with an emotional farewell, as Katniss asks Gale to care for Prim and convey her love.

Quote: "Thanks! Take good care of Prim and tell her that I love her and that I will come back."

This conversation sets the stage for Katniss's journey in the Hunger Games, highlighting her motivations, fears, and the support she leaves behind.
